The Royal Hospital Chelsea is an Old Soldiers’ retirement and nursing home for some 300 veterans of the British Army.  King Charles II founded the Royal Hospital as a retreat for veterans in 1682.

Royal Military Police (RMP) Veterans are eligible to become Chelsea Pensioners, who receive care and accommodation at at the Royal Hospital Chelsea. To be eligible, individuals must be in receipt of their state pension, have served in the British Army (regardless of rank), be free of any financial obligations to a spouse or family, and be able to live independently.  The Corps currently has one of the largest contingents at RHC, to find out further information please use the link below.
